Generation Independent – Photographed for the pre-spring issue of i-D Magazine; models Cara Delevingne, Codie Young, Charlie Bredal, Louise Parker and Magda Laguinge pose for Richard Bush (Trouble Management) in a series of youthful images. Stylist Sarah Richardson selects easy silhouettes from the likes of Saint Laurent, Maison Martin Margiela, Valentino and Jil Sander. For beauty, hair stylist James Rowe and makeup artist Mathias van Hooff create the girls relaxed looks. Casting by Barbara Nicoli & Leila Ananna @ Trouble Management
